
Enterprise Information Archiving Export Formats
The goal of enterprise information archiving is to collect, preserve, and make available an organization's email and other electronic communications following legal, regulatory, and corporate requirements. To support these objectives, enterprise information archiving systems provide various export formats for accessing archived data.

Export Formats
Enterprise information archiving systems support a variety of export formats for accessing archived data. The most commonly supported export formats are listed below.
MIME: The MIME (Multipurpose Internet Mail Extensions) format is the standard format for email messages. MIME messages can be exported from an enterprise information archiving system and viewed in any email client that supports the MIME format.
PDF: PDF (Portable Document Format) is a standard format for document exchange. PDF documents can be exported from an enterprise information archiving system and viewed in any PDF viewer.
TIFF: TIFF (Tagged Image File Format) is a standard format for storing images. TIFF images can be exported from an enterprise information archiving system and viewed in any TIFF viewer.
PST: PST (Personal Storage Table) is a proprietary format used by Microsoft Outlook for storing email messages. PST files can be exported from an enterprise information archiving system and imported into Microsoft Outlook.
Enterprise information archiving systems also support a variety of other export formats, including XML, CSV, and HTML.
